Shot in reverse day-by-day through a week—a local sheriff embarks on a quest to unlock the mystery of three small-town criminals and a bank heist gone wrong.
2012
2023
2021
2024
2014
2022
2020
1993
2002
2018
2003
2025
2026
2007
2011